
By making even moderate changes to renewable energy and energy efficiency policies at the Federal level, the new administration can create jobs. These policy changes will help workers put gas in their cars, food on their tables, and give people hope and reason to care about the little: picking up those flimsy plastic bags littering our neighborhoods, and the big: creating a sustainable future for our children and grandchildren.
The American Solar Energy Society released a report on January 15, 2009 stating that "green" industries generated $10.3 billion in sales and accounted for more than 4% of Colorado's state product in 2007. That translates into 91,000 jobs in this state alone that were provided by renewable energy industries. The report also stated that nationally, over 9 million jobs and 1 billion dollars in revenue were generated by "green" industries. Read more...

The Orton Family Foundation is changing the way communities approach land planning, and they're doing it with heart and soul.
Founded in 1995 by Noel Fritzinger of Weston, Vermont and Lyman Orton, proprietor of mail- order business The Vermont Country Store, the foundation helps small cities and towns look with more than hope to the future. Citizens and their leaders are given tools, research, guidance and capital.
The idea is to promote inclusive decision making and land use planning by getting people to talk about what's important to them in their communities.
